Webcommon words on the blackboard and the children highlight as many as they can find. Younger children may need to be given a highlighter each or you may ask that each common word is highlighted using a different colour. This activity can also be used to highlight a spelling pattern in older classes e.g. ‘ight’ , ‘ei/ie’. WebNext taking one root at a time, they research other words which contain that root. These words become part of their spelling list. This can be done individually or with a partner. If working with a partner, they can test each other’s spelling and understanding of the word. They could use the words, to create a class illustrated dictionary ... Webaber, (and) inver both mean river mouth or confluence, the ‘inver’ prefix being the commoner. Inverness – the mouth of the Rive Ness, is the best-known. achadh field. Common Gaelic prefix – Achnasheen – the fairy field or Achnashellach – the field of the willows. ard, aird high point – Ardnamurchan – the point of storms. Web26 de set. de 2024 · Scottish Gaelic is written with 18 letters of the Latin alphabet. Traditionally each letter is named after a tree or shrub, however the names are no longer used. Inscriptions in Ogham have been found in Scotland, however it is not certain what language they are in.
